Injury Saints Starting Cornerback Sidelined     -- Mon Nov 16 1:30 pm --

Sprained MCL
METAIRIE, La. -- New Orleans Saints coach Sean Payton says starting cornerback Tracy Porter has sprained his left knee and could return this season. Porter injured his left knee in a collision with Saints safety Usama Young during New Orleans' victory in St. Louis on Sunday. Payton says tests Monday revealed a medial collateral ligament injury, which will not require reconstructive surgery. (CBSsports.com)

FF Today's Take: Porter should return before the end of the season. Malcolm Jenkins and Randall Gay should see their roles in the defense expand.
